What Is Mickey's Not So Scary Halloween Party?


Mickey's Not So Scary Halloween Party is a special ticketed event held on select nights from August through Halloween. Unlike traditional Halloween parties, this event is designed to be fun and spooky without being scary, making it perfect for guests of all ages. The park transforms with themed decorations, special shows, unique character meet-and-greets, and exclusive treats.

Guests can enjoy trick-or-treating throughout the park, watch a spectacular Halloween parade, and see fireworks that light up the night sky with eerie colors and effects. The event also features unique entertainment that you won’t find during regular park hours.


Dates and Tickets for 2026


The 2026 party dates have been announced, running from August 7th through October 31st on select evenings. Tickets must be purchased separately from regular park admission. Prices vary depending on the date, with weekends and closer-to-Halloween dates generally costing more.


Tips for buying tickets:


  • Purchase early to secure your preferred date, especially for weekends. Most evenings have the potential to sell out.

  • Check for discounts if you are an Annual Passholder or Disney Vacation Club member.

  • Consider buying multi-night tickets if you plan to attend more than once.


Tickets grant entry starting at 7 PM, but guests with tickets can enter Magic Kingdom as early as 4 PM on event days.

What to Expect at the Party


Entertainment Highlights


  • Mickey's Boo-to-You Halloween Parade

This parade is a fan favorite, featuring Disney characters in Halloween costumes, spooky floats, and the infamous Headless Horseman who rides through the park to kick off the parade.


  • Hocus Pocus Villain Spelltacular

A live stage show starring the Sanderson Sisters from Hocus Pocus. Expect catchy songs, dancing villains, and magical effects.


  • Disney’s Not So Spooky Spectacular Fireworks

A fireworks show with projections, lasers, and music that celebrate the lighter side of Halloween.


Character Experiences


Many beloved Disney characters appear in special Halloween costumes. You can meet:


  • Mickey and Minnie in their Halloween outfits

  • Jack Skellington and Sally from The Nightmare Before Christmas

  • Disney villains like Maleficent and the Evil Queen

  • Winnie the Pooh and friends in their halloween costumes

  • Other rare characters who only appear during the party


Trick-or-Treating and Food


Trick-or-treat stations are scattered throughout Magic Kingdom, offering candy and treats for kids and adults alike. You can bring your own bag or use the special party-themed treat bags available for purchase.


Themed snacks and drinks are available at select food carts and restaurants. Look for pumpkin-flavored treats, spooky cupcakes, and specialty beverages.

Tips for a Great Experience


  • Dress in Costume

Guests are encouraged to wear costumes, but keep them family-friendly and comfortable for walking. Avoid masks that cover the entire face for safety reasons.


  • Arrive Early

Enter the park at 4 PM to enjoy regular attractions before the party officially starts at 7 PM.


  • Plan Your Parade and Show Viewing

The parade and fireworks are very popular. Find a spot at least 30-45 minutes before showtime for the best views. We've watched from Frontierland and had a great view!


  • Use the Disney App

Check wait times, character locations, and event schedules in real time.


  • Stay Hydrated and Take Breaks

Florida evenings can still be warm. Drink water and rest when needed.


  • Plan out your Experience

  If you have additional time to visit Magic Kingdom, use that time to check out rides. Use the party time to experience the unique character meet and greets, check out the yummy treats and take in the Boo-to-You parade and nighttime fireworks!
